数据结构的基本类型

线性数据结构 数组(Array):一组具有相同类型的数据元素按一定顺序排列的集合。数组中的每个元素都可以通过索引快速访问。链表(Linked List):由一系列节点组成,每个节点包含数据部分和指向下一个节点的指针。链表分为单向链表、双向链表和循环链表等。

非线性数据结构有哪些(什么叫非线性数据结构)

数据结构的基本类型主要包括线性结构和非线性结构。线性结构:定义:线性结构是指表中各个结点具有线性关系,有且仅有一个开始结点和终端结点,所有结点都最多只有一个直接前驱节点和一个直接后继节点。常见类型:数组:一种线性表数据结构,用连续的内存空间来存储数据元素,可以通过下标快速访问。

数据结构的基本类型主要包括以下几种: 线性数据结构 数组(Array):一组具有相同类型的元素按一定顺序排列的集合,可以通过索引快速访问任意元素。链表(Linked List):由一系列节点组成,每个节点包含数据部分和指向下一个节点的指针。链表分为单向链表和双向链表等。

线性数据结构:数组:具有固定大小的数据集合,可以存储相同类型的元素,元素通过索引访问。链表:元素通过指针或引用相连,可以动态地增加或减少元素,访问元素时需要通过从头节点开始遍历。栈:遵循后进先出原则的数据结构,常用于函数调用、表达式求值等场景。

数据结构根据数据元素间关系的不同特性,常分为以下四类基本的结构:集合结构:说明:该结构的数据元素间的关系是属于同一个集合,即元素之间没有特定的顺序或关联,只是简单地被归为一组。线性结构:说明:该结构的数据元素之间存在着一对一的关系,即每个元素都有且仅有一个直接前驱和一个直接后继。

线性结构和非线性结构有哪些

1、非线性结构:非线性结构包括:二维数组、**数组、广义表、树结构、图结构。数学用语,其逻辑特征是一个结点元素可能有多个直接前驱和多个直接后继。传统文本(例如书籍中的文章和计算机的文本文件)都是线性结构,阅读是需要注意顺序阅读,而超文本则是一个非线性结构。

2、非线性结构是指数据元素之间存在多种不同的关系,每个元素可能有多个直接前驱和直接后继,或者没有前驱和后继。非线性结构包括树和图等。树:是一种非线性结构,它的数据元素之间存在一种层次关系,每个元素可能有多个直接后继,但只有一个直接前驱。

3、小说结构主要包括以下几种类型: 线性结构 线性结构是最常见的小说结构形式。这种结构按照时间顺序或事件发展的逻辑顺序推进故事,从开端到发展,再到**和结局。故事的情节发展线索清晰,每个部分都紧密相连,呈现出连贯性。这种结构易于理解和接受,适合讲述简单明了的故事。

非线性结构有哪些

非线性结构的类型如下:树形结构:具有分支、层次特性,形态类似于自然界中的树。树形结构由节点和边组成,每个节点可以有多个子节点,但每个子节点只能有一个父节点。常见的树形结构有二叉树、平衡二叉树、红黑树等。图状结构:图由节点和边组成,节点表示实体,边表示节点之间的关系。图可以有循环和多条边,分为有向图和无向图。

非线性结构的类型主要包括以下几种:树形结构:每个节点可以有一个或多个子节点,但只有一个父节点。这种结构常用于数据存储和管理,如文件系统或数据库索引。常见的树形结构有二叉树、红黑树等,特点是层次清晰,信息指向性强。图结构:由节点和边组成,节点代表实体,边代表实体间的关系。

非线性数据结构主要包括以下三类: 集合结构 特性:集合中的任何两个数据元素间不存在逻辑关系,组织形式松散。这意味着在集合中,元素之间是相互**的,没有明确的顺序或层级关系。集合结构常用于存储那些不需要考虑元素之间关系的场景。

- 栈:特殊线性表,仅在表的一端进行插入和删除,也即栈顶操作。- 队列:特殊线性表,仅在表的一端插入,另一端删除,分别称为队头和队尾。 非线性结构 非线性结构的特点是数据元素之间的关系多样化,一个元素可能拥有多个直接前驱和后继,或者根本没有。

非线性数据结构有哪些

1、非线性数据结构主要包括以下三类: 集合结构 特性:集合中的任何两个数据元素间不存在逻辑关系,组织形式松散。这意味着在集合中,元素之间是相互**的,没有明确的顺序或层级关系。集合结构常用于存储那些不需要考虑元素之间关系的场景。 树形结构 特性:树形结构具有分支和层次方面的特性,其形态类似自然界中的树。

2、树(Tree)树是一种基本的非线性数据结构,它是由 n(n0)个结点组成的有限集合,其中有一个被定为根节点,其余的结点可以分为 m 个互不相交的集合 TTT...、Tm,这些集合本身也是树结构,称之为原树的子树。树结构的数据访问和遍历方法有广度优先和深度优先两种。

3、非线性结构的类型主要包括以下几种:树形结构:每个节点可以有一个或多个子节点,但只有一个父节点。这种结构常用于数据存储和管理,如文件系统或数据库索引。常见的树形结构有二叉树、红黑树等,特点是层次清晰,信息指向性强。图结构:由节点和边组成,节点代表实体,边代表实体间的关系。

关于非线性数据结构有哪些和什么叫非线性数据结构的介绍到此就结束了,不知道你从中找到你需要的信息了吗?如果你还想了解更多这方面的信息,记得收藏关注本站。